1. Lead Follow-Ups

Lead follow-ups are crucial in keeping your name top-of-mind with potential buyers or sellers. However, manually following up can take hours out of your week, and there’s always the risk of letting leads fall through the cracks. Automating this process ensures every lead is nurtured consistently and no opportunity is missed. By setting up automated workflows, such as drip email campaigns, text follow-ups, or even task reminders, you can stay on top of outreach without having to manually manage each interaction.

2. Appointment Reminder

Scheduling and managing appointments are key components of any real estate agent’s business. However, missed appointments or clients forgetting showings can lead to lost opportunities and wasted time. By automating appointment reminders, you ensure that both you and your clients stay organized and prepared. Automation reduces no-shows, maintains a professional image, and provides a seamless experience for everyone involved.

3. Social Media Post

In today’s digital age, maintaining a strong social media presence is essential for building your brand and attracting leads. But posting consistently can be overwhelming when you’re juggling multiple listings, clients, and appointments. Automating your social media posts allows you to maintain an active online presence while saving valuable time. By batch-creating and scheduling content in advance, you ensure that your audience remains engaged without having to manually post every day.

5. Email Sequences

Email remains one of the most effective marketing tools in real estate, especially when nurturing leads or maintaining relationships with past clients. However, writing and sending individual emails for each client can be time-consuming and exhausting. Automating your email sequences allows you to deliver personalized, timely content to your clients—whether it's for lead nurturing, property updates, or post-sale follow-ups—without the need for constant manual effort.
